10 Best Wine Brands per India 2018
People per India have discerning taste per wine and spirits and this is why wine brands have made it personalità per the Indian market. Many of the brands have alla maniera di up with wines, which give tough competition to some leading international brands. It takes a lot of care to prepare the best wine and some of the wines are aged for getting the right and the taste. There are basically three types of wine which are sold per India. One of them is red grape wine, the second one is the white wine and the third one is port wine. Port wine is inexpensive and that is one of the reasons for its popularity but for the other two, there are many brands available across per India. Some of the brands like Sula have a lot of variety available and per addition to this these brands are used by the cima chefs for cooking per hotels like Taj and Bukhara. Wine also make a perfect gift for the people you love and the wine is a key ingredient of any occasion to make it perfect. This article is for you if you are looking for one of the best wine brand available per India.
10. Fratelli Sangiovese Sclerotica
The word Fratelli (Italian) implies brothers. Fratelli Wines is a coordinated effort of Indian and Italian families getting together to bring the Tuscan quality and taste of wine, developed per Indian atmosphere and territory. Their winery home is per the Solapur district close to Pune with the vineyards adjacent too. Wine analysis – Alcohol: 13.5 – Total Acidity: 5

9. Dindori Reserve Shiraz
Next the list of cima 10 best wine brands per India 2015 is Dindori Reserve Shiraz, a product of Sula Vineyards. The wine, which has a full taste, makes a perfect combination with lamb and duro cheese. The price is pocket friendly at Rs 850 for 750 ml.

8. Seagram’a Nine Hills
Seagram’a Nine Hills is another wine brand, which has touched the heights of popularity per the country. It presents a unique taste with the fruity blend of strawberry and cherry. The wine can be had with fried as well as spicy dishes, making it perfect for the Indian palate. The product comes at a fair price of Rs 565 for 750 ml.

7. Barrique Reserve Shiraz
Another wine brand which has amassed a great deal of popularity per India is Barrique Reserve Shiraz, which comes from the house of Four Seasons. Containing the wonderful of some spices and blackberry, the wine blends well with matured cheese, red meat and mushrooms. Price is reasonable at Rs 900 for 750 ml.

6. SETTE
SETTE is a product of Fratelli Vines, based per Akluj. The best thing about this wine which accounts for its huge fan following per the country is that it makes a perfect combination with Indian food. It carries hints of vanilla and citrus flavors. The price is the high end, at Rs 1650 for 750 ml.

5. Chateau d’Ori Merlot
Next the list comes the wine called Chateau d’Ori Merlot, which is derived from this wonderful tasting grape called Merlot. Being stored per oak barrels gives it an even more outstanding taste and . It can be paired with all kinds of meat.

4. Cabernet Sauvignon Reserve/Revelio
Cabernet Sauvignon Reserve is appreciated by wine lovers because of its kicking taste and spicy , with quaderno of cinnamon, pepper and nutmeg. It is considered ideal to be had with lamb dishes. A 750 ml of the wine is priced at Rs 1345.

3. Grover La’ Reserve
La Reserve is the most seasoned Reserve wine delivered per India by Grover Vineyards per the mid-nineties. Notwithstanding a brief period a couple of years back, it has been viewed as one of the Best Indian red wines with great esteem and well worth for you money also.La Reserve red wine delivered from their finest Cabernet Sauvignon and Shiraz grapes, the wine is made per the best French winemaking customs of Bordeaux. Matured per French oak barrels, this profound ruby wine has a bunch of ripe red organic products with a hint of spiciness and an agreeable oaken flavour and a long, waiting lingering flavour.

La Reserve is a surge of ripe organic product yet positively. There are additionally quaderno of chocolate and vanilla. The fruit and oak contain each other and the tannins adjust the two. The wine has a close impeccable landing as it were. It’s impressive and amazing consistency throughout the years explain the splendid name. The wine is quite affordable, priced at Rs 800 for 750 ml.

2. Rasa Shiraz
Featuring next the list of cima 10 wine brands of India 2015 is Rasa Shiraz, a product of Sula Vineyards of Nashik. The vintage red wine is loved for its classic and is used per preparing barbecues and several other dishes. It comes at a price of Rs 1175 for 750 ml.

1. Chene Grand Reserve
Another widely recommended wine brand from the house of Grover Vineyards is Chene Grand Reserve, which is loved for its brillante and wonderful taste. The wine is the most expensive one per the country and has been honored with the Hong Kong International Wine Award per 2013. Price is Rs 1700 for 750 ml.
